How do I hide the Office clipboard icon on my screen? When I am copy/pasting
information, the clipboard icon appears right over the area where I am trying
to paste, and hides the text around my paste destination, making it difficult
to put the pasted item in the correct place. I have tried selecting the
options for the Office clipboard to turn it off, but it still does not stop
the icon from appearing on my page right where I need to paste.
 
Have you disabled the Paste Options button in the appropriate place in your
version of Word (which you haven't told us)?

Sorry, I have Word 2002, and Windows XP. I'm not sure where to find the
Paste Options button. Is that on the toolbar? Thanks
 
In Word 2002, the check box for the Paste Options button is on the Edit tab
of Tools | Options.
